Lindsey Decker
Lindsey Decker (1923–1994) was an American artist.
His work was included in the 1966 exhibition Eccentric Abstraction held at the Fischbach Gallery in New York City.[1] His work part of the collections of the National Gallery of Art in Washington, DC,[2] the Whitney Museum of American Art[3] and the Detroit Institute of Arts.[4]
